Yadda 3.0.0, a JavaScript BDD library update, was largely built by Anthropic's Claude Code, demonstrating AI agents' capability in software modernization. - The release highlights a shift towards AI-driven development for executable specifications, improving software quality. - Claude Code managed the modernization epic, breaking down work into phases and generating significant code contributions. - The project's success suggests increasing value for AI agents in maintaining and evolving complex codebases.
